Here was a good question asked the USCG lately.
"I continue to be dumbfounded by what happened to the 110s," Taylor
said during a House hearing March 8. "You are in the business of
running marine safety inspections on every commercial ship in
America , so how the heck do you stretch eight ships and render them
useless, spend $100 million in taxpayers money and nobody in your fine
organization catches this?"
